Claims
- 1. An elastic, laminated disposable diaper comprising: a liquid-impermeable backing comprised of a pressure sensitive film having an outer backing fabric laminated to said elastic film, said backing fabric having at least about 25% extensibility, an absorbent core and a liquid-permeable facing comprised of fabric having at least about 25% extensibility and being coextensive with said backing, said absorbent core being laminated between said facing and said backing.
- 2. The disposable diaper of claim 1 wherein said absorbent core is comprised of a loosely compacted cellulosic fibrous bat.
- 3. The disposable diaper of claim 1 wherein said pressure sensitive film is a hot melt adhesive.
- 4. The disposable diaper of claim 1 wherein said initially molten film is a foam.
